When it comes to footwear, sneakers have transcended their athletic origins to become a staple in everyday fashion. Their versatility allows them to be paired with a myriad of outfits, from casual to semi-formal. However, the question remains: what color sneakers can seamlessly integrate into any wardrobe? In this post, we will explore the colors that not only complement a wide range of styles but also enhance your overall aesthetic.
1. The Power of Neutral Colors
White Sneakers: The Timeless Classic
White sneakers are arguably the most versatile option available. Their clean and minimalist design allows them to pair effortlessly with virtually any outfit. Whether you’re donning a casual jeans-and-T-shirt ensemble or a more polished look with chinos and a blazer, white sneakers provide a fresh contrast that elevates your appearance. Brands like Adidas Stan Smith and Nike Air Force 1 exemplify this timeless style.
Black Sneakers: The Understated Elegance
On the other end of the spectrum, black sneakers offer a sleek and sophisticated alternative. They can be dressed up or down, making them suitable for both casual outings and more formal occasions. Black sneakers work particularly well with darker outfits, providing a cohesive look. Consider options like the Allbirds Tree Runners or the classic Converse Chuck Taylor in black for a versatile addition to your collection.
2. The Allure of Earth Tones
Beige and Tan Sneakers: The Subtle Statement
Beige and tan sneakers are gaining popularity for their ability to blend seamlessly with a variety of colors and patterns. These earthy tones evoke a sense of warmth and can be paired with denim, khakis, or even floral prints. Brands like Veja and New Balance offer stylish options in these shades, making them an excellent choice for those looking to add a touch of sophistication without overwhelming their outfit.
Olive Green Sneakers: The Trendy Neutral
Olive green has emerged as a trendy neutral that pairs well with both muted and vibrant colors. This versatile hue can add a unique twist to your outfit while maintaining a grounded aesthetic. Olive green sneakers can be styled with everything from casual shorts to tailored trousers, making them a worthy investment for any fashion-forward individual.
3. The Impact of Bold Colors
Navy Blue Sneakers: The Versatile Alternative
While neutrals dominate the conversation, bold colors can also play a significant role in a versatile sneaker collection. Navy blue sneakers, for instance, offer a refined alternative to black. They can be paired with denim, khakis, or even lighter shades, providing a polished yet relaxed look. Brands like Nike and Puma offer stylish navy options that can easily transition from day to night.
Red Sneakers: The Statement Piece
For those willing to make a bolder choice, red sneakers can serve as a striking focal point in an outfit. While they may not be as universally compatible as neutral colors, red can add a pop of excitement when styled correctly. Pairing red sneakers with neutral outfits—such as black jeans and a white tee—can create a balanced look that draws attention without overwhelming the senses.
4. Tips for Choosing the Right Color Sneakers
– Consider Your Wardrobe: Before investing in a new pair of sneakers, take stock of your existing wardrobe. Identify the colors and styles you wear most frequently, and choose sneakers that will complement those pieces.
– Think About Versatility: Opt for colors that can transition between different occasions. Sneakers that can be worn casually during the day and dressed up for evening outings will provide the most value.
– Quality Over Quantity: Instead of amassing a large collection of sneakers in various colors, focus on acquiring a few high-quality pairs in versatile shades. This approach not only simplifies your choices but also ensures that you invest in durable footwear.
